Solar Tube Repair in Seattle, WA
Solar tube repair services address issues related to the skylights that bring natural light into interior spaces through tubular channels. These services typically cover the inspection, sealing, and replacement of damaged or malfunctioning components such as the reflective tubing, domes, or flashing. Property owners often seek repairs when they notice reduced light levels, leaks, or cracks in the skylight fixtures, aiming to restore optimal daylighting and prevent water intrusion.
Before requesting solar tube repairs, property owners should understand the scope of the service, including whether the work involves simple sealing or complete replacement of parts. It’s also helpful to consider the age and condition of existing solar tubes, as well as any visible damage or leaks. Clarifying these details can ensure the repair process addresses the specific issues affecting the skylights and helps maintain the integrity of the interior lighting system.

Solar Tube Repair Questions
What are common issues with solar tubes? Common problems include leaks, cracking, or light dimming due to damage or debris blocking the tube.
Can solar tubes be repaired instead of replaced? Yes, many issues such as leaks or cracks can be repaired to restore proper light transmission.
What should property owners consider before repairing a solar tube? It's important to assess the extent of damage and ensure the repair will restore proper function and appearance.
Are repairs suitable for all types of solar tubes? Repairs are typically effective for most standard solar tube systems, but some damage may require replacement of components.
